The third generation of the Satisfyer Pro 2 gets a magical vibration upgrade. Its previous style of clitoral stimulation through intense pulsations, popular throughout the world, has now been combined with supremely erotic vibrations which set the rim of the lay on head into joyful motion. The skin friendly ring made of medical Silicone encloses your pleasure bead and caresses the inner area with 11 different non-contact pressure wave intensity settings. Meanwhile, a separate set of controls makes the outer ring vibrate around your clitoris in 10 intensity settings. The result? Pure ecstasy. Your clitoris would sing with joy if it could! The design of the new Satisfyer Pro 2 Vibration combines the usual refined rose gold in matte finish with a new, slim shape that scores points thanks to it ergonomic bumps and curves. While this pretty pleasure giver sits perfectly in your hand, the two functions of the wide lay on head caress your love bead intensely. However, thanks to the whisper quiet motor, the only attention it will attract is yours. The waterproof finishing IPX7 means that it is also your perfect companion for sensual pleasures in the shower or bathtub. Underwater, the tingling sensation is even more intense! The head, made from skin friendly silicone, has also been optimized. It is now bigger and wider so that it can surround your clitoris even more effectively, allowing you to forget the world while it provides you with stimulation ranging from tender to intense in 11 exciting steps. A Broad Overview, But Light on Modern Fine-Tuning
Format: Paperback
I'm currently really interested in fine-tuning LLMs and recently completed my first LoRA-based fine-tuning on a quantized model. I came to this book looking for more detail on fine-tuning. While it touches on the topic, I found the content didn’t quite align with the current state of the field in 2025. Techniques like LoRA, QLoRA, and PEFT weren’t really covered, and the material leaned more toward what I think are older or lower level approaches. That made it harder to connect with what I’m actually working on. That said, when I shifted to other chapters — like the sections on prompt engineering techniques such as Chain of Thought (CoT) and Tree of Thought (ToT) — I found more value. These sections were clearer, and I picked up a few practical insights, like using few-shot examples that walk through the CoT reasoning process. That’s not something I’ve tried before, and I can see how it might help smaller models that struggle with any type of reasoning tasks. Overall, the book feels more like a broad overview of all LLM concepts. For someone exploring many topics across the LLM ecosystem, it offers a wide-ranging introduction. But for readers like me who are actively trying to learn and apply techniques like fine-tuning and quantization, it may leave you wanting up-to-date guidance.
